I wrote my poem in response to Mish’s d’Verse Quadrille #216 – Can you take a hint? prompt. To write a quadrille poem of just 44 words that includes the word hint.
Hint of a Smile

His face was stern
as we trudged over dyke and stile,
I told a joke for a laugh—
his face stayed long like a giraffe!
Mile by mile
we walked like this,
then, with a hint of a smile,
He gave me a kiss.
Lesley Scoble, January 2025
